Signs and symptoms
Many people believe that only children have ADHD however, it can affect adults as well. If not treated, ADHD symptoms can interfere with a person's ability to find and keep jobs, maintain healthy relationships, spend money wisely and also take care of their physical health issues. In certain instances, a person may become so overwhelmed by unmanaged ADHD symptoms that they develop comorbid conditions like anxiety or depression.
ADHD symptoms are usually divided into three categories that include hyperactivity (or impulsiveness), inattention, and an impulsiveness. While everyone has these behaviors at times, individuals with ADHD exhibit these behaviors in a way that can significantly impact their lives and can cause persistent problems. The symptoms include difficulty in staying focused or paying attention to instructions, frequent interruptions to conversations, problems with time management or planning and putting off deadlines and appointments, ignoring important items (e.g., eyeglasses, keys, wallets) or putting off work in the absence of meeting performance goals at school or work, and frequently losing possessions.
Anyone who suspects that they may have ADHD should see an expert for an assessment. This could be an expert in mental health, like a psychologist or psychiatrist or a primary healthcare provider such as a family physician. Some people also choose to utilize an online ADHD evaluation service to help find a doctor who is familiar with this disorder and its treatment options.
During the examination, the doctor will interview you about your medical history and current issues and how your ADHD symptoms affect your daily activities. The doctor will also inquire with you about your family history, and whether any of your relatives has been diagnosed with ADHD. An evaluation may also include an examination of your body and blood tests to rule out other problems, such as lead poisoning or sleep disorders which may cause similar symptoms.
After the evaluation, the doctor will suggest a treatment plan, that could include therapy, medication, or other lifestyle adjustments. They will also discuss your eligibility for accommodations at school or work under the Americans with Disabilities Act, which could include extended test times and quiet test environments. In certain instances the doctor may recommend an MRI in order to determine if there are any other medical conditions that could cause your symptoms.
Diagnosis
A private ADHD assessment is a great way to help adults who are struggling at school or work due to their attention-deficit hyperactivity disorder. Many people believe their symptoms are affecting their work, relationships, or their quality of life. They need to be aware of their condition so that they can receive the proper treatment and support.
If you have tried self-diagnosing yourself by taking online quizzes or questionnaires, and are still having difficulty in your everyday life, it may be worthwhile asking your doctor to refer you to an ADHD assessment at an accredited private adhd assessment coventry hospital or private Adhd assessment near me wellness centre. The staff at these centres are experts in identifying ADHD in adults and are able to arrange an appointment swiftly.
During the diagnosis process, the doctor will interview you to discuss your symptoms as well as your medical history. You will be asked to explain the effects of your ADHD symptoms on your daily routine and relationships as well as the length of time you've suffered from them. They will also use a range of tests and measures to assess your cognitive abilities. These include your IQ and memory, inkblots and mental health. They might also ask you to self-report your ADHD symptoms. You might be asked to complete puzzles and timed tasks.
Keep in mind that there are many other conditions that exhibit similar symptoms as ADHD. Your psychiatrist will make sure that all other diagnoses have been eliminated before determining a definitive diagnosis. These include depression, anxiety and some comorbid conditions like dyslexia and autism. If a psychiatrist suspects that you may have a comorbid condition they will treat it alongside your ADHD to ensure that both the root cause and symptoms are treated.

Treatment
If you are diagnosed with ADHD there are many treatments available. Medication is the most commonly used treatment and can help to alleviate symptoms by increasing levels of dopamine in the brain. There are two kinds of medication that are used in the treatment of ailment: stimulants and non-stimulants. Both have their pros and cons, so it's crucial to discuss the various options with your physician.
During your private ADHD assessment, you'll be asked questions about your symptoms and how they impact on your life. The psychiatrist will also conduct an extensive psychiatric examination, which could take up to 90 minutes. The test can be a bit intimidating initially, but it's normal and will aid you in understanding the situation.
You might be asked to complete questionnaires or fill in other paperwork ahead of the appointment. This will allow the psychiatrist understand your symptoms and their impact on you so that they can make a precise diagnosis. Your psychiatrist will be able to discuss with you a treatment program that is adapted to your needs. Not everyone will require medication. People who require it will be given the option of stimulants or nonstimulants that are designed to increase the dopamine levels in the brain and to reduce symptoms.
The diagnosis is based on the quantity of symptoms you've experienced as well as the length of time they've been present, and how much does private adhd assessment cost much they interfere with your life. It is only possible to be diagnosed by a psychiatrist, specialist nurse or another mental health professional who is certified to prescribe medications. Psychologists and other mental health professionals are not able to diagnose you formally (although they might be able to offer support). You also need an official diagnosis of psychiatric illness to be eligible for protections in the workplace under the Equality Act 2010.

Support
ADHD can be a terribly difficult and frustrating condition. It's not uncommon for adults with the disorder to feel like they are not understood by anyone. Some people might think that they're lazy or have a negative attitude. Their relationships may be affected, particularly with their close family and friends. This can cause problems at work or at school. Untreated, it may result in unemployment and Private adhd assessment Near me social isolation.
There are a number of ways to obtain an ADHD assessment and diagnosis for adults. A referral from your physician will allow you to access many private healthcare providers. You can also get in touch with a mental health service such as Priory hospitals or wellbeing centers. They can set up an appointment with an experienced therapist who is skilled in diagnosing ADHD. You will be asked to complete an assessment in advance to ensure that the doctor has a clear understanding of your symptoms.
If you've been diagnosed with ADHD your counselor will be able to assist you in managing your symptoms with various treatment techniques. These may include c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) or interpersonal psychotherapy (IPT). There are also medicines that can be used to control the symptoms of ADHD. These medications cannot treat ADHD, so it is important to be monitored by a doctor.
Certain medications may have their own list of side effects, and are not suitable for everyone. Your therapy provider will inform you about the various options available. They will be able to suggest the most appropriate medication for your symptoms, lifestyle, and your personal preferences.
A few adults who suffer from the inattentive subtype of ADHD are easy to miss because they don't exhibit the typical hyperactive or impulsive behaviours that are typical of the disorder. They are typically quieter than their peers, and they might not have the same disciplinary problems as their peers. They could be mistaken for depressive or anxiety disorders by medical professionals who fail to recognize the root of the problems. If untreated and not diagnosed, ADHD can have serious consequences, including relationship issues, academic failure, financial difficulties and delinquency, as well as addiction to alcohol or drugs.
